Output 046529153557ac1788a58339741870efc20e8c8dae1c5b8dec2b7a2829dafe0c:9

value
1474860548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ecc388da4b233f1115c4175308f0be84f011ac OP_EQUAL
address
3EuJroeQkDWZbRqAtjm2BKJ4Dk9o3GzWiP
transaction
046529153557ac1788a58339741870efc20e8c8dae1c5b8dec2b7a2829dafe0c
spent
true